{"id":23062,"count":1,"description":"Island City is a city in Union County, Oregon, United States. Its name originally came about due to it being located on an island between the Grande Ronde River and a nearby slough. However, the slough was later diverted, removing the city's island status. The population was 916 at the 2000 census.\nAccording to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 0.9 square miles (2.3\u00a0km), all land.\nAs of the census of 2000, there were 916 people, 357 households, and 280 families residing in the city. The population density was 1,055.3 people per square mile (406.5\/km\u00b2). There were 375 housing units at an average density of 432.0 per square mile (166.4\/km\u00b2). The racial makeup of the city was 95.41% White, 0.22% African American, 1.20% Native American, 0.76% Asian, 0.33% Pacific Islander, 1.09% from other races, and 0.98% from two or more races.
